About
Nestled in the foothills of the Conejo Valley, Los Robles Greens Golf Course is less than 40 miles from L.A. but feels much further thanks to the beautiful mountain surroundings. It sits at 900 feet above sea level and tumbles across a variety of elevation changes. The towering, mature oaks that line the fairways characterize the course. The diverse layout offers both wide and narrow fairways, water hazards, and thick cuts of rough. The undulating greens are also lightning fast. The course is a fair challenge but still gentle enough to appeal to a range of skill levels. Although it is a public golf course, the beautiful setting and excellent course conditions gives Los Robles Greens the feel of a private club, which makes it a great value for the price.
